一般使用的抓包工具,win:Fiddler,Mac:Charleshtml
但今天的主角并不是这两上古神兽,而是基于nodejs的浏览器端抓包工具Livepool
node
npm install -g livepool
livepool
启动成功输出以下:git
须要用到SwitchOmega,下载地址:https://github.com/FelisCatus...github
安装后按以下方式配置npm
而后打开127.0.0.1:8002,以下:浏览器
菜单区网络
Session(显示全部http请求信息)session
TreeView(使用树状结构显示Session信息)工具
功能Tab: Pool(按照项目管理本地替换规则)post
功能Tab: Inspector (session查看器,查看请求header,body等信息)
功能Tab: Composer(http请求模拟器,能够模拟http get/post请求)
功能Tab: Filter(session过滤器,根据规则过滤session,只保留关注的)
功能Tab: Log(日志显示)
功能Tab: Timeline(session时间轴,comming soon)
功能Tab: Statics(统计,对站点性能进行评估,comming soon)
接下来,打开任意网站,好比掘金社区,再看抓包页面
能够看到已经抓取到访问信息
这里用的是每天模拟器,预先准备好了追书神器APP进行抓包,找到系统设置->点击WIFI->长按WiredSSD->点击修改网络->选择显示高级选项,而后填写如图所示
打开追书神器,任意点击,将会在抓包页面看到获取到了访问信息
首先PC下获取你本身的局域网ip地址,好比个人是192.168.0.102,打开iPhone的WIFI设置,设置http代理以下:
以后,在iPhone上的操做都能在抓包页面获取到
原文地址:使用livepool抓包